The FORD MONDEO (2000-07) 5DR ESTATE 2.5 V6 170 ZETEC S is a versatile family estate car that combines practicality with a sporty touch. Positioned within the UK market as a spacious and reliable choice, this model is ideal for those needing ample boot space and seating for families or outdoor enthusiasts. Its estate design offers flexibility for everyday driving, whether you're commuting, running errands, or embarking on longer trips. The car's distinctive 2.5 V6 engine delivers a good balance of performance and smoothness, making it a standout in its class for those seeking a more dynamic drive.
